洛阳申达电脑维修服务公司
首页 | 联系方式 | 加入收藏 | 设为首页

电脑维修

联系方式

联系人:温小姐
电话:0379-8260505
传真:0379-8260505
邮箱:service@szdingshi.com

当前位置:首页 >> 新闻中心 >> 正文

如何给光驱添加关闭命令

编辑:洛阳申达电脑维修服务公司   时间:2013/07/01   字号:
摘要:如何给光驱添加关闭命令
不知为什么,在微软目前的操作系统中,光驱的命令菜单都是只有“弹出”命令,没有“关闭”命令。如果不想按光驱的按钮关闭弹出的托盘,就不得不依靠安装第三方软件来实现。今天信维科技教大家用VBScript语句弥补这点不足。
关闭所有光驱:
如果系统中安装了一个以上的光驱,那么打开记事本,输入以下代码:
Set wm p=Create Object(WMPlayer.OCX.7)
Setcdrom=wmp.cdromCollection
If cdrom.Count=1then''(该句用来判断你的系统中装了多少个光驱)
Forz=0tocdrom.Count-1
cdrom.Item(z).Eject
Next
Forz=0tocdrom.Count-1
cdrom.Item(z).Eject
Next
EndI
注意将文件类型改为“所有文件”后,将文件保存为“关闭所有.vbe”,在桌面上为该文件建一个快捷方式,以后双击桌面上的快捷方式就可以关闭所有弹出的光驱。
关闭指定的光驱:
以下语句可以让你关闭指定的光驱,例如要关闭第一个光驱,我们可以新建个一文本文件,输入以下代码:
Setwmp=CreateObject(WMPlayer.OCX.7)
Setcdrom=wmp.cdromCollection
cdrom.Item(0).Eject
同样将该文件保存为后缀为VBE的文件,命名为“close1.vbe”,以后双击该文件即可关闭你系统中的第一个光驱盘符。在以上语句里,item(0)中的“0”代表第一个光驱盘符,如果要关闭第二个光驱盘符,请将这里的“0”加1,依此类推,就可实现关闭指定的盘符了。
还可以将“关闭”添加到光驱的右键菜单中。方法是在注册表编辑器中依次展开[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Drive\shell]分支,然后在右侧窗口中新建“CloseCDROM”分支,进入该分区后,在右侧窗口双击“默认”,将其默认值修改为“关闭所有”;再点击“编辑→新建→项”,将新键重命名为“command”,把“默认”值修改为“C:\WINDOWS\System32\WScript.exeC:\关闭所有.vbe”(这里要将C:\改为“关闭所有.vbe”文件在你系统中保存的路径)。
上一条:在Window XP中共享上网 下一条:“死锁”介绍——信维科技